2008-05-04から1日間の記事一覧

ただのメモ

「*Main>」の部分が何かはてなで表示がおかしいけど、まあいいや。 StringとCharを連結 *Main> (++ "hoge") $ (head "hoge"):"" "hhoge" 先頭文字を取り出して、同じかどうか確認 *Main> 'h' == (head $ head $ lines "hoge\nfuga") True tailsとisPrefixOf…

Haskellリハビリ

適当に。parser作りまでGW中に行け…ないかな。。。 list = [1,2,3,4,5] main = do print $ mySum list print $ mean list print $ var list -- sumはすでにあるけど、実装してみた mySum :: [Double] -> Double mySum list = foldl (+) 0 list mean :: [Doub…